    Curiosity has risen, out of the general AvX thread.

    How do the Storm fans feel about Storm and Black Panther battling during their respective searches-for-Hope in Wakanda.
    Both of them will be in Wakanda, alongside their hunting parties.

    Personally, I would find it a disservice to Ororo's character to attack Black Panther and vice versa.

    Whether one agrees with their marriage or not (I know its a hot button for many a Storm fan) do most agree that assaulting her husband would be extreme? And the same for him attacking her?

    I mean....summoning a flurry of focused air currents to subdue and/or confine Black Panther? Sure. Absolutely. Slow his ass down and keep him from going at your teammates.
    And the same goes for the Panther. If he sneaks up on her and gives her a nerve pinch or something to leave her unconscious with little physical violence, I'd accept it. I certainly won't like it, but its far better than her taking a fist to the face, right?

    But if these two characters resorted to physicaly assaulting one another? Boo.
    I'd have a tough time wrapping my head around it, given their relationship, regardless of their superhero statuses.

    Thoughts?
